Circular references in Excel can be quite the conundrum, can't they? 😅 If you've ever found yourself puzzled by error messages or inconsistent results in your spreadsheets, you know what I mean! Thankfully, understanding and resolving these references doesn't have to be a painful process. With a few handy tips and tricks, you can not only clear up the confusion but also enhance your overall Excel skills. Let’s dive into how you can troubleshoot and avoid circular references like a pro.
What Are Circular References?
Before we jump into solutions, let’s clarify what a circular reference actually is. A circular reference occurs when a formula refers back to its own cell, either directly or indirectly. For example, if cell A1 contains a formula that refers to cell A2, and cell A2 refers back to cell A1, you have a circular reference. This can lead to Excel displaying a warning message and producing erroneous calculations.
Why Circular References Are Problematic
- Confusing Errors: Circular references can lead to confusing errors, which might cause you to question your data’s reliability.
- Performance Issues: They can slow down your workbook, especially if there are multiple circular references across various sheets.
- Inaccurate Calculations: When calculations are dependent on each other, they can lead to non-deterministic results.
How to Identify Circular References
Excel has some built-in tools that can help you spot circular references. Here’s how to find them:
- Check for Error Messages: If a cell contains a circular reference, Excel will usually notify you with a pop-up warning.
- Review the Status Bar: When a circular reference exists, the status bar at the bottom of your Excel window will display a message about it.
- Use the Formulas Tab: Navigate to the “Formulas” tab, then click on “Error Checking,” and select “Circular References.” Excel will provide a list of cells with circular references, helping you to locate the issue quickly.
Steps to Resolve Circular References
Once you’ve identified the offending formulas, you can follow these steps to resolve circular references:
-
Examine Your Formulas: Look at the formulas in the affected cells. You might find that they need to be adjusted or restructured.
-
Break the Loop: Decide which cell's reference needs to be changed. You may need to create a new cell that uses one of the values but doesn’t include the circular reference.
-
Use Iterative Calculations: In some cases, circular references are necessary for certain calculations (like calculating compound interest). You can allow Excel to perform iterative calculations. Here’s how:
- Go to
File
>Options
. - Click on
Formulas
. - Under
Calculation options
, checkEnable iterative calculation
. - Set the maximum iterations and maximum change to fit your needs.
- Go to
-
Recalculate Formulas: Sometimes a simple recalculation can solve the issue. Press
Ctrl
+Alt
+F9
to recalculate all formulas in the workbook.
Advanced Techniques for Managing Circular References
Use of Helper Columns
When dealing with complex formulas that might cause circular references, consider utilizing helper columns. This means breaking down your formulas into smaller, more manageable parts, which can help to avoid circular dependencies.
Conditional Formatting
Use conditional formatting to highlight cells that are affected by circular references. This will not only help you keep track of these cells but also assist in quickly resolving the issues.
Error Checking Formulas
Using the IFERROR
or ISERROR
functions can help manage errors that result from circular references. For instance, wrapping your formulas in an IFERROR
can provide a default value instead of displaying an error message.
Common Mistakes to Avoid
- Ignoring Error Messages: Always pay attention to the warnings Excel provides. Ignoring them could lead to larger problems down the line.
- Overcomplicating Formulas: Keep your formulas as simple as possible. When they are complex, they can easily lead to unintentional circular references.
- Failing to Use Absolute References: Use absolute references (by adding a $ sign) when necessary to prevent unwanted circular references.
Troubleshooting Circular Reference Errors
If you encounter persistent circular reference errors despite your best efforts, here are a few tips to troubleshoot:
-
Review Dependent Cells: Check all cells that might be affected by the circular reference. Sometimes the issue lies deeper than the visible formula.
-
Test Changes Incrementally: If you’re unsure which formula is the cause, make changes to one formula at a time. This way, you can easily identify what resolves the issue.
-
Use Formula Auditing Tools: Excel provides formula auditing tools that allow you to trace precedents and dependents. Use these tools to see which cells are influencing the circular references.
Tips and Shortcuts for Efficient Use of Excel
- F2 Shortcut: Pressing
F2
allows you to edit the current cell without having to double-click it. - CTRL + Z: This classic shortcut lets you undo recent changes if you find you've made a mistake.
- CTRL + A: Quick way to select all data in your worksheet, allowing for easier data manipulation.
<div class="faq-section"> <div class="faq-container"> <h2>Frequently Asked Questions</h2> <div class="faq-item"> <div class="faq-question"> <h3>What is a circular reference in Excel?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>A circular reference in Excel occurs when a formula refers back to its own cell, causing a loop in calculations.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How can I find circular references in Excel?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>You can find circular references by checking for error messages, reviewing the status bar, or using the “Error Checking” feature under the “Formulas” tab.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>Can I use circular references intentionally?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>Yes, in certain scenarios like iterative calculations, you can intentionally use circular references by enabling iterative calculations in Excel options.</p> </div> </div> <div class="faq-item"> <div class="faq-question"> <h3>How do I fix a circular reference error?</h3> <span class="faq-toggle">+</span> </div> <div class="faq-answer"> <p>To fix circular reference errors, check and adjust your formulas, break the loop by changing cell references, or use iterative calculations if necessary.</p> </div> </div> </div> </div>
Summarizing everything we've discussed, dealing with circular references doesn't have to be overwhelming. By identifying these references early, breaking loops, utilizing helper columns, and applying Excel’s built-in error-checking tools, you can achieve error-free calculations. If you ever face circular reference errors, remember to stay patient, methodically troubleshoot, and don’t hesitate to experiment with your formulas.
Whether you're a beginner or a seasoned Excel user, practice makes perfect! Dive deeper into these features, explore more advanced functions, and continue improving your Excel skills. Happy Excelling!
<p class="pro-note">🔍Pro Tip: Regularly check your formulas for circular references to keep your Excel workbooks in top shape!</p>